One Detroit Credit Union strengthens leadership team with appointment of COO Stephanie Peoples

With 20 years of experience and a commitment to financial equity, Peoples joins incoming CEO Portia Powell to advancement innovation and increase access

Detroit, MI (April 14, 2025) |

One Detroit Credit Union is pleased to welcome Stephanie Peoples as its new Chief Operating Officer (COO). An experienced financial services leader and a lifelong proponent of economic empowerment, Peoples joins the organization with more than 20 years of experience and an unwavering dedication to community banking. 

Peoples comes on board as executive leader at a landmark for One Detroit, as the credit union gets ready to mark its 90th anniversary and launches a new chapter under new CEO Portia Powell, the organization’s first woman and African American CEO. Powell and Peoples will together lead the organization’s ongoing expansion, innovation, and steadfast dedication to financial inclusion.

In this new role, Peoples will be responsible for operational strategy and implementation across the organization with a focus on expanding access to cores services, creating high-performing teams, and establishing internal systems that support long-term growth. Her near-term priorities include strengthening operational soundness, expanding business lending, and expanding community engagement through education and nonprofit collaborations.

“I was drawn to One Detroit because of its mission. It’s not just about banking. It’s about being present in the community, solving real problems, and changing lives,” said Peoples. “I’m excited to work alongside Portia Powell to drive meaningful impact through lending solutions, financial literacy, and member-focused innovation.”

Peoples comes to One Detroit following a 21-year career at JPMorgan Chase, where she held various leadership positions as district manager and senior business consultant in the Minority Entrepreneur Program. Her professional efforts to serve small businesses throughout Michigan were aimed at assisting historically under-scored entrepreneurs in accessing capital, expanding strategically, and developing sustainable businesses. This is perfectly with One Detroit’s mission to serve members who do not have access to conventional bank services.

Peoples is a hands-on leader and is motivated by what she calls her "People Principles": members, employees, processes, productivity, and profitability. She sees herself as a servant leader, a perfectionist, and a leader who leads with structure, along with empathy.

“I am thrilled to have Stephanie Peoples as the Chief Operating Officer of One Detroit Credit Union,” said Powell. “She brings an energizing blend of industry knowledge, operational focus, and a true heart for the community. I’m confident her leadership will help us deepen our impact and elevate the member experience.”

Her personal motto, “Be the change you want to see,” embodies her values-based leadership style. Peoples is driven to grow financial literacy, homeownership, and access to affordable, community-based financial solutions such as youth savings account, consolidation loans, and life insurance, for Detroiters.
